In the absence of oxygen, cells utilize anaerobic fermentation.
Lactic acid fermentation: pyruvate is converted to lactic acid and in the process NAD+ is regenerated. This process allows glycolysis to continue to produce ATP. Lactic acid fermentation is done by animals, including us.
In certain bacteria and yeasts: pyruvate is converted into ethanol and CO2 is released. This is how beer, wine and bread are produced.
